NZD: Potential to be influenced by the latest GDT dairy auction - BNZ

Kymberly Martin, Senior Market Strategist at BNZ, suggests that the NZ data delivery was not a big driver of the NZD/USD yesterday.

Key Quotes

“The ANZ business survey was not materially changed from its previous reading. However, the NZD/USD has stepped steadily higher since yesterday morning, trading at 0.6760 at present. There is potential for it to be influenced by the latest GDT dairy auction that takes place in the early hours of tomorrow morning. We would be more surprised to see a big drop than a modest tick-up in average prices.”
